Stitch Density & Fabric Considerations
Given the likely complexity of the truck and landscape elements, stitch density could be a concern. Too dense, and it might stiffen the fabric; too loose, and the details may not pop. I’d recommend testing on a few fabric thicknesses—particularly heavier sweatshirt fleece and lighter cotton blends—to find the right stabilizer match.
A medium-weight cutaway stabilizer would likely offer the best support for the design’s detail level. For dark fabrics, using a light-colored underlay thread might help maintain contrast and clarity. Hoop placement should be carefully planned, especially for curved areas like sleeves or the back neckline, to avoid distortion after washing.
